Zelenskyy says Putin's 'words' aren't enough as he speaks with Trump on energy ceasefire

President Donald Trump spoke with Ukrainian President Volodymyr Zelenskyy on Wednesday as talks continue to try to end the Russia-Ukraine war.

Summary

Trump and Ukrainian President Zelenskyy discussed a partial ceasefire on energy infrastructure following Trump’s failed attempt to get Putin to agree to a 30-day ceasefire.

Trump briefed Zelenskyy on his talk with Putin, who only pledged to halt attacks on energy sites. Zelenskyy welcomed the step but said Putin’s words alone were “not enough.”

Russia and Ukraine continued to exchange strikes despite the talks.

The U.S. will help Ukraine acquire more air defenses, and intelligence sharing will continue despite Russia’s demand to halt Western military support.
